Gaynor Arnold was born and brought up in Cardiff. She read English at St. Hilda’s College, Oxford, where she acted in many plays, including at the Edinburgh Festival and in the USA.

She has two grown up children and works for Birmingham’s Adoption and Fostering Service.

She is a social worker whose debut novel has been nominated for the 2008 Booker Prize said her tale of marital misfortune was partially inspired by working with dysfunctional families.But she has failed to make the six-novel shortlist for the Man Booker Prize.

Alfred Gibson’s funeral has taken place at Westminster Abbey, and Dorothea, his wife of twenty years, has not been invited. The Great Man’s will favours his children and a clandestine mistress over his estranged wife. Dorothea is left only with the comforts of her feisty youngest daughter Kitty, whose attempts to demonise her father challenges Dorothea’s memories. When an invitation for a private audience with Queen Victoria arrives, she begins to examine her own life more closely.

Dorothea revisits their courtship, early days of nuptial pleasure and domestic family fun-before the birth of too many children sapped her vitality. But she also uncovers the frighteningly hypnotic power of this celebrity author. Now Dodo will need to face her grown-up children, and worse, her dual nemesis of ten years before, her redoubtable younger sister Sissy and the charming actress Miss Ricketts.
